Transaction f30ea35e205d61ed56db3580a516a05d5759650155828d97730f452cb2ee472d

3 Input
1 Outputs
  • f30ea35e205d61ed56db3580a516a05d5759650155828d97730f452cb2ee472d:0
  • value  12128496
    address  3GUgWabvDEJaN2PrPdeZyyHL4CaecvLcU1